Stop me if you’ve heard this one before but the UFC has officially announced that the long-awaited fight between UFC Light Heavyweight champion Jon Jones and Glover Teixeira will take place in early 2014.
Originally, both men were scheduled to meet on Super Bowl weekend at UFC 169 in New Jersey before scheduling conflicts forced the company to move the fight to UFC 170 in Las Vegas. But the fight was once again rescheduled due to lingering injuries to Jones.
Jones is, of course, coming off a unanimous decision victory over Alexander Gustafsson at UFC 165, a fight that left both men bruised and bloodied after 25 minutes of back-and-forth action.
Initially, Jones was open to the idea of granting Gustafsson an immediate rematch, but upon reviewing the fight and determining it was not as close as initially thought, he decided it was time to move on to a new opponent.
Teixeira, currently the No. 2 ranked light heavyweight according to the official UFC fighter rankings, is coming off a tough first-round TKO victory over The Power MMA Show’s Ryan Bader at UFC Fight Night 28. That victory not only pushed his winning streak to five straight wins inside the octagon, but to 18 straight overall dating back to 2006.
UFC 171 is scheduled to take place March 15, 2014 in the American Airlines Center in Dallas. No other fights have made official for the card.
